Using Credit Cards to Save Money on Business Expenses

Cash Back Rewards

Earn Cash Back: Credit cards like the Capital One Spark Card offer 2% unlimited cash back, while the American Express Plum Card offers 1.5% unlimited cash back.

Offset Fees: Using a credit card with cash back can partially offset the 2.95% process fee, reducing the effective cost.

Tax Benefits

Tax-Deductible Fees: The 2.95% process fee can be filed as a tax-deductible business expense, offering some financial relief.

Additional Tax Breaks: Depending on the jurisdiction and tax codes, you may be eligible for additional tax breaks for using credit cards for business expenses.

Cash Flow Management

Cash Float Period: Credit cards often provide a 30 to 45-day payment window, allowing businesses to manage their cash flow better.

Utilize Funds: During this period, the funds can be invested in short-term opportunities or other revenue-generating activities.

Floating Revenue from Bank

Float Revenue – Cash Incentive Earnings: The funds in your bank account for 30 to 45 days could earn Cash incentive or be invested in short-term revenue-generating activities.

Capital Utilization: The cash float period allows you to strategically utilize your capital for other pressing needs or investment opportunities.

Detailed Example: Capital One Spark Card

  1. Process Fee: 2.95%
  2. Cash Back: 2%
  3. Tax Break: 0.06%
  4. Final Fee: 0.35%
  5. Additional Benefit: 30-45 days of cash flow management and float revenue.
